Honeywell Life Support Products
Connected Breathing Regulator and Anti G (cBRAG)
CBRAG
The latest in hybrid duplex breathing regulator and anti G technology supplies oxygen enriched breathing gas to the aircrew and inflates aircrew trousers as required for flight conditions.
Breathing Regulator and Anti G
Honeywell also offers man-mounted, panel mounted and mechanical seat-mounted breathing regulators, stand-alone anti-G valves (AGV), and combined breathing regulator and anti-g-valves (BRAG).

On Board Oxygen Generation (OBOG)
The OBOG produces and controls oxygen enriched breathing gas from a conditioned engine bleed supply by means of the principle of Pressure Swing Absorption (PSA).

Carbon Monoxide Removal Catalyst (COCAT)
Ambient temperature CO removal catalyst that removes CO down to a few ppm in the breathing gas supply.

Integrated Controllers and Sensors
Honeywell develops, designs, qualifies, and delivers integrated control systems and sensors that control the pilots’ oxygen systems (OBOG, BOS, EOS) and provide diagnostics and prognostics for improved in-service operations. Our systems will also be able to provide advanced data analytics to better understand the pilots’ environment. Sensors include a state-of-the art oxygen sensor within the Solid State Controller Oxygen Monitor (SSOM) that monitors and controls the oxygen levels produced by the On-Board Oxygen Generation (OBOG) concentrator to meet the desired physiological requirements of the aircrew.

Honeywell Test Facilities
Honeywell environmental control and life support test facilities include Altitude chambers able to simulate operation up to 65,000 feet with high flow, pressure, and temperature, Centrifuge, Vibration, Shock and Gunfire Testing, Environmental Qualification (Salt Fog, Tropical Exposure, Sand & Dust, Waterproofness, Magnetic Effects, Temp/Alt/Humidity)
